Web23 hours ago · The phrase “get woke go broke,” employed by some conservatives on social media, suggests that brands which employ inclusive campaigns are angering a significant … WebAug 26, 2024 · The process for inclusive safety When you are designing for safety, your goals are to: identify ways your product can be used for abuse, design ways to prevent the abuse, and provide support for vulnerable users to reclaim power and control. The Process for Inclusive Safety is a tool to help you reach those goals ( Fig 5.1 ).
